Nairobi – Deputy President Rigathi Gachagua once again he has reprimanded the MPs of the Kenya Kwanza coalition who are planning to remove him from power.
What did Gachagua say about the plan to remove him from leadership?
Speaking to an enthusiastic crowd at Marikiti Market, NairobiFriday, September 20, Gachagua claimed there are plans to remove him from power and make him a puppet.
The second leader claimed that many MPs of the coalition Kenya First they had been bribed to remove him.
Gachagua, angry, warned the plotters that they would not succeed, insisting that Kenyans elected him, not the MPs.

“I was elected by Kenyans, not MPs. They pay MPs to threaten me, but let me remind you, I was elected by Kenyans, and only Kenyans can decide if I should go home,” Gachagua said.
Gachagua criticized the MPs behind the plot to remove him, saying they are selfish.
“We have private MPs. When businessmen were being evicted here in Marikiti, they were busy in Nyahururu planning how to threaten me instead of working for the people they elected,” he added.
